Cellular Energy Deficiency & Weight Gain: A Comprehensive Guide

Many sufferers experience a confusing cycle: feeling constantly tired despite adequate sleep , and simultaneously battling unwanted weight increase . This isn’t always about straightforward calorie imbalances; often, it’s rooted in a deeper cellular energy deficiency. Your cells, the building blocks of your body, require a consistent supply of energy – primarily in the form of adenosine triphosphate (ATP). When this generation is hampered, your metabolism slows down , triggering your body to store energy as fat. Factors leading to this cellular imbalance can include nutrient deficiencies , mitochondrial dysfunction (the “power plants” of your cells), chronic stress , and exposure to harmful substances.
